How is Mini Heroes delivered?

Mini Heroes is taught through story-led scenarios featuring the Mini Heroes characters. Pupils follow relatable situations, talk through what is happening, then practise the calm, helpful actions they could take.

Watch

Children watch short, age-appropriate first aid stories and expert demonstrations.

Discuss

Questions and answers are built into the slides, helping staff guide the conversation with confidence.

Do

Children practise safely through hands-on activities, role play and physical resources, building confidence without making it scary.

Staff do not need to create lessons from scratch. Presentations are ready to go, lesson plans guide each step, and pupils learn through characters, stories and practice, not just facts on a slide.

What Mini Heroes covers

Mini Heroes is designed for children aged 4–11, with age-appropriate first aid learning across EYFS, Key Stage 1 and Key Stage 2.

EYFS

Helping others, recognising when someone needs help, and knowing how to get an adult.

Key Stage 1

Safety awareness, emergency calls, asking for help and simple first aid actions.

Key Stage 2

Emergency calls, common injuries and age-appropriate life-saving skills.

KS2 topics include asthma, allergies, bleeding, burns, head injuries, choking, bites and stings, plus a bonus CPR session for Upper KS2.

Do staff need to be first aid trained?

No. The course is “Video-Led.” Your role is to facilitate. You move through the clearly sequenced slides, all questioning is planned into the sides, along with the answers. Press play on the video section and our expert trainers demonstrate the skills on screen. You then guide the children through the practical activities using our detailed session plans.
